Ballets with a Twist is bringing its dazzling production, Cocktail Hour: The Show, to San Juan College’s Henderson Fine Arts Center on Friday, September 12, 2025, at 7:00 p.m., as part of the San Juan College Artists Series. Tickets are free, thanks to KSJE’s 35th Anniversary, and can be reserved online at www.sanjuancollege.edu, by phone: 505-566-3430, or in person at the Henderson Fine Arts Center Box Office.
Created by artistic director and choreographer Marilyn Klaus, Cocktail Hour: The Show mixes the glamour of Hollywood with the excitement of modern dance. This unique ballet experience brings your favorite cocktails to life on stage from the sultry “Bloody Mary” to the timeless “Manhattan,” plus mocktail favorites like “Roy Rogers.” Performance highlights include:
• Cin Cin — A romantic dance with a continental twist
• Hot Toddy — A roaring 1920s romp filled with mischief
• Grappa — A lively revival based on Italian folklore
The Farmington performance will feature the world premiere of “Bombay,” an all-new female quartet with an original score.
Suitable for audiences of all ages, this fun and fast-paced show transports theatergoers through time and around the world with original choreography, music and costume design. You’ve never seen ballet like this!
